NEW YORK CITY-Little changes have been seen this week in short- and long-term mortgage rates. The average value for 30-year fixed-rate mortgages reach 4.88% this week from 4.87% last week.

The average value for 15-year fixed-rate loans remained unchanged at 4.15%. The one-year adjustable rate decreased from 3.23% to 3.21%. According to the Mortgage Bankers Association, mortgage applications increased just about 16% last week.
